We are all involved in club work in some way. " District II President, KAREN'S KOINER Karen Lewallen, "DON'T PAY THOSE DUES JUST YET!! I know a lot of us like to go ahead and get dues in early, but this year there's a change on the horizon! Due to a change in the GFWC by-laws, dues will be increasing by $1.00 per member. This will affect the 04-05 and 05-06 club years. That means our GFWC of Tennessee dues will need to increase to $13.00 per member this year. This will be addressed more fully at Fall Conference, but we did want to give everyone a "heads-up". The information will also be in your GFWC of Tennessee handbooks under the Treasurer's information; and extra handouts for club treasurers will be available at Fall Conference, also.
